How do you get the Deku Leaf in Wind Waker?

How do you get the Deku Leaf in Wind Waker?

The Wind Waker The Deku Leaf is obtained in the Forest Haven from the Great Deku Tree, after the wise Earth Spirit had to interrupt the Korok ceremony because of Makar getting lost in Forbidden Woods.

How do I help the Deku tree in Wind Waker?

Follow the small river up to the massive tree and stand on the lilypad. The Great Deku Tree will wake up and be covered with Red and Green ChuChus. Roll into the tree to knock off all the enemies and then defeat them with your sword.

How do you get Korok leaves?

Korok Leaves can be obtained by cutting down coniferous trees, non fruit-bearing trees and palm trees. Trees that have apples and Hearty Durians, or Mighty Banana sprouts, don’t drop them. Korok Leaves can create gusts of wind that will blow objects away.

Can Korok Leaf break?

Korok Leaves are flammable and can be used to transfer flames. However, they will disintegrate if left ablaze for too long. Swinging a Korok Leaf without hitting a solid object will not damage the Leaf’s durability.
